Pregnancy Alerts as Drugmaker Accepts Contraceptive Slip-up

Pregnancy Alerts as Drugmaker Accepts Contraceptive Slip-upIn a shocking incident, it has been revealed that the world’s biggest drug company, Pfizer, has summoned up in excess of 1 million packs of contraceptive pills following a recent disclosure in which it was revealed that the birth-control pills were muddled up in packs. As a result, claims are being made that a large number of women might be at the risk of unwanted or unintended pregnancy.

FDA Gives Green Signal to Pfizer’s INYLTA

FDA Gives Green Signal to Pfizer’s INYLTAAs per reports, it has been revealed that the Food and Drug Administration (FDA) has given a green signal to Pfizer for its new oral treatment INLYTA. The oral drug is meant for patients who have been suffering from advanced Renal Cell Carcinoma (RCC).

Pharmacy Guild Under Fire For New Deal

Pharmacy Guild Under Fire For New DealIs one of the world's biggest drug companies following spurious means to escalate its profits? Perhaps that's what Australian pharmacists by and large believe in. It has been told that as per a deal signed between Pfizer and Pharmacy Guild of Australia in July, Pfizer would pay pharmacies $7 as administration fee in lieu of getting a patient signed up for their much touted support program.

Pfizer Aims to Become Sole Distributor of Medicines

Pfizer Aims to Become Sole Distributor of MedicinesThe National Pharmaceutical Services Association has organised "No Monopoly on Medicines" movement this year, after the declaration made by Pfizer who plans supply the medicines directly to retailers rather than getting it supplied through distributors.
